Estrogen hormone is a sex hormone that is found in both men and women. But it is more important in women, so it is also called female hormone. Because these hormones are responsible for the sexual development of internal functions of the body, such as reproduction and growth in women, it is also called the female development hormone. Estrogen hormone is a large part of the changes in the body of a woman with age. In this article, we will discuss “What is the Function of Estrogen Hormone in Females.”

Estrogen in women is produced every month from cholesterol, mainly in ovaries.

In addition, some production takes place in the adrenal gland (adrenal cortex) and some in the embryo and placenta.

The function of the estrogen hormone in females

This hormone causes the following changes in women.

  • Start of menstruation
  • Breast development
  • Growth of genitals and armpit hair

 

Importance of estrogen in menstruation or menstrual cycle:

1. The estrogen hormone and progesterone hormone together regulate the menstruation cycle properly.

2. Both hormones have the lowest levels during the period.

3. On the fifth day of the period, an egg is selected; the egg is in the follicle inside the ovary. The composition of this follicle itself produces estrogen.

4. From the sixth to the fourteenth day, the estrogen hormone slowly increases rapidly. This can be called ovulation preparation.

5. On the fourteenth day, the follicle layer is removed from the top of the egg, and the ovary releases the egg into the fallopian tube to get fertilized by mixing sperm.

 

6. If the egg is not fertilized from the 15th to the 28th day, the estrogen and progesterone hormone level decreases rapidly. Due to this, the menstrual cycle starts again.

7. It also plays an important role in the premenstrual disorder.

8. Steroid type of estrogen hormone is essential for breastfeeding.

 

Another function of the estrogen hormone

1. Prevents infection and inflammation.

2. Reduces mental stress.

3. Strengthens bones; this hormone works with vitamin D to strengthen bones, but its levels decrease with age.

This is why women's bones become weaker as they age, which means the possibility of osteoporosis increases.

4. Prevents Uterus and Breast Cancer.

 

5. Increases sex drive.

6. Increases the glow of skin and hair because estrogen increases the level of collagen of the skin, reducing wrinkles and making the woman look attractive.

7. Helps to reduce blood clotting and maintains the smoothness of the vagina.

8. Controls cholesterol.

Low Estrogen Levels

Following are the symptoms of deficiency of estrogen hormone:

1. Experiencing pain during sex due to lack of vaginal lubrication

2. Lack of sex drive

3. Have a swing

4. Sudden heat and sweating

5. Changes in cholesterol level

6. Migraine

 

7. Irregular period

8. Anxiety

9. Irregular discharge

10. Urine infection

11. Menopause

12. Osteoporosis

13. Polycystic ovarian syndrome

14. Decreased concentration and fatigue
